Correctly attach tail text to the last element/comment/pi, even when comments or pis are discarded.
Also fixes the insertion of PIs when "insert_pis=True" is configured for a TreeBuilder.

I think it would be nice to add a test case for Whitespace Processing, something like:

<a>text
  <!-- comment -->
  tail</a>

I can't tell off the top of my head what the text value should be :)
Apparently Py3.7 just yanks the comment and leaves a.text == "text\n \n tail" (GitHub renders this incorrectly, it's -newline-space-space-newline-space-space-)

My compiler complains of logical ops not being explicit enough. Personally I think it's silly, but the rest of CPython code base uses explicit parentheses in such cases, if ((a && b) || c).

/Users/user.surnam/cpython/Modules/_elementtree.c:3639:35: warning: '&&' within '||' [-Wlogical-op-parentheses]
        if (target->events_append && target->pi_event_obj || target->insert_pis) {
            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 ~~
/Users/user.surnam/cpython/Modules/_elementtree.c:3639:35: note: place parentheses around the '&&' expression to silence this warning
        if (target->events_append && target->pi_event_obj || target->insert_pis) {
                                  ^

Hi Stefan, I'm afraid there's a memory leak, consider this program:

from xml.etree import ElementTree
while True: ElementTree.fromstring("<a>text<!--c1-->a<!--c2-->b<!--c3-->foo</a>").text

d395209, common ancestor with master branch: ~5MB, stable
21cd0bd bpo-37399_missing_tail branch: grows to ~800MB in about a minute, probably unbounded
